Briana DeJesus vs. Mackenzie McKee: Teen Mom Feud Alert!

When MTV announced that Briana DeJesus would be joining the cast of Teen Mom 2 for the show’s upcoming season, the news was met with a fair amount of confusion. After all, the show certainly wasn’t lacking in storylines, and none of the existing cast members had left the series, so why bring in yet another mom? Now, it seems that TM2 producers were aware of some very important information about Briana: The girl has an incredible talent for bringing the drama. Already, DeJesus has feuded with Jenelle Evans and pissed off several of the other ladies – and she hasn’t even made her debut on the show yet. Now, it seems Briana is butting heads with a mom who’s not even associated with MTV’s most popular frianchise anymore. Mackenzie McKee starred alongside DeJesus in the ill-fated Teen Mom 3 , which lasted for just one season. She openly expressed her shock and surprise after learning that producers chose Briana instead of her to joing the cast of TM2. That was several months ago, but it seems Mackenzie is still a bit salty about the decision: As you can see, Mackenzie liked a tweet in which a fan complained about the addition of Briana to the cast. DeJesus took a screen shot and retweeted it along with a simple question: why? Mackenzie didn’t respond to Briana’s query, but did go on to rant about someone who follows her on social media only to “spread hate.” “I don’t hate anyone. I’ve always loved this person. But I can promise she hates me,” McKee tweeted, adding that she blocked the unidentified hater. There’s little doubt that McKee was talking about DeJesus, and she’s been open about her distaste for her former co-star for quite some time: “I hope MTV didn’t choose her over me because I am married and have three kids with the same guy,” she told Radar Online back in March. “The story on different baby daddies is what people are interested in.” We’re beginning to think MTV should also add Mackenzie to the cast for the sake of some old-fashioned feud drama. Mariah Carey and Nicki Minaj Confirm American Idol Departures

American Idol is minus another judge. With Randy Jackson having official resigned his post and Jennifer Hudson reportedly on the way , Mariah Carey made it official today: She has left the series after one season. “W/ global success of ‘#Beautiful’ (#1 in 30+ countries so far) @MariahCarey confirms world tour & says goodbye 2 Idol,” read a message from Carey’s publicists PMK-BNC that the singer re-Tweeted shortly thereafter. “Mariah Carey is a true global icon — one of the most accomplished artists on the planet — and we feel extremely fortunate that she was able to bring her wisdom and experience to the American Idol contestants this season,” noted a joint release from FOX, FremantleMedia and 19 Entertainment. “We know she will remain an inspiration to Idol hopefuls for many seasons to come.” Are you sad Mariah is leaving American Idol?   No, good riddance! Blue Power Ranger Reveals He Quit Show ‘Over Gay Insults’

David Yost, who played nerdy triceratops commander Billy on the ’90s kids show Mighty Morphin’ Power Rangers , revealed that he left the series because he was “called ‘f*ggot’ one too many times [by the show’s] creators, producers, writers, directors.” He added that he became “worried that I might take my own life.” Sad.
